I second the magnetic oil plug. I personally went with a Greddy. If you decide to do this, make sure you buy a quality plug. Some of the cheaper ones just glue the magnet on to the plug. I have read the glue can break down and the magnet can fall off invto the oil pan. That's definitely not a good thing.
